Highly efficient CHP plant Tierpark Berlin
Planning of a natural-gas-fuelled CHP plant with an electrical capacity of 600 kW to provide the priority supply of the Tierpark Berlin with electric energy.
The highly efficient CHP plant to be installed into the existing central heating plant of the Tierpark has a thermal capacity of approx. 650 kW and shall also be used in future to provide the base heating load of the Tierpark. The CHP plant will be engineered to extent the existing system in terms of heat and electricity.

Client Tierpark Berlin-Friedrichsfelde GmbH
Place / Period Berlin / 2011 until 2012
   
 
 
 

Gas-fired CHP plant Helmshäger Berg
The turbine CHP plant Greifswald was planned by BLS Energieplan in 1990. As part of the comprehensive turbine revision it was examined whether to install a gas turbine or a motor. The motor is more advantageous because of its higher electrical efficiency, among others.
Technical data of the existing plant
- Boiler plant with a thermal capacity of 5 x 20 MW
- Gas turbine plant with an electrical capacity of 2 x 5 MW
Technical data of the extended plant
Gas motor with an electrical capacity of 4.5 MW
Objective
Ensuring the cost-effectiveness of the power generation and heat production costs in a sustainable way

Cooling systems Tegel Airport
Concept planning and planning of the cooling renewal of the Berlin Tegel Airport.
Due to the high demands regarding the supply security of the airport, the existing cooling system had been reengineered.
According to the concept result, a compression refrigeration system with a cooling capacity of 3.5 MW was installed for covering the basic load. In view of the future peak load supply, the hydraulic and electrical interfaces have been prepared in the form of a distribution/collection system.
Services
Planning of the technical system from determining the basics to construction supervision (work phases 1-8 of HOAI)

Central energy facility South, Max Delbrück Center
The Max Delbrück Center for Molecular Medicine in Berlin-Buch replaces and expands its central systems for supplying and distributing heat, cold and electricity.
Against this background, BLS Energieplan GmbH plans a combined heat, power and cooling system with absorption and compression refrigeration systems as well as CHP modules for providing steam, hot water and electric energy.
The cold water distribution network on the premises of the Max Delbrück Center is being modernised and expanded.
Installed cooling capacity: approx. 3.5 MW
Installed thermal capacity: approx. 1.2 MW
Installed capacity of self-generated power: approx. 1.1 MW

Woodchip-fuelled plant Neuenkirchen
The woodchip-fuelled plant with a capacity of 117 kW combined with a gas-fuelled peak load boiler was constructed in the municipality of Neuenkirchen near Greifswald and ensures the operational optimisation of an existing stand-alone solution for generating heat for a firefighter building, kindergarten, secondary school and community centre.
By changing the heat supply from oil to a combination of wood and gas, an annual saving of 142 tons of CO2 was reached. The investment costs of the plant amounted to approx. €182,000, of which 30% were sponsored through the climate protection funding programme of the federal state of Mecklenburg-Western Pomerania.

Max Planck Institute (Plasma Physics) - cooling circuits for the fusion research experiment W7-X
In December 2005, in a public competitive limited invitation to tender issued by the Max Planck Institute for Plasma Physics (Greifswald Branch Institute), BLS Energieplan was awarded the contract for the planning and construction of the cooling circuits for the fusion research experiment "Wendelstein W7-X". The experiment is part of the research activities on the road to development of a fusion power plant. The stellator "W7-X", which is now coming into being in the IPP Greifswald Branch Institute is to demonstrate the suitability of the "Stellator" experimental model for implementation in power plants.
In this context, the cooling circuits to be constructed by BLS Energieplan serve for controlled heat dissipation of the plasma, which is heated with 10 megawatts of power via microwave plasma heating.
